Does A Hot Tub Have To Run All The Time. One of the most common questions our team gets asked is should i leave my hot tub on all the time? quite simply, the answer is yes. Water chemistry and filtration will also be maintained if the hot tub remains powered. The short answer is yes, you should leave your hot tub on all the time. Your hot tub is designed to be left switched on. You should leave your hot tub on 24/7. Frequently turning it off and on, or frequently lowering and raising the. Initially, that might sound quite daunting, but for the long term health of your hot tub, and your bank balance,. Usually, people keep their hot tubs at 100°f (37.7°c). Yes, you should leave your hot tub on all the time to ensure the hot tub is in good working order. Most sources i’ve read stipulate that keeping your hot tub about 5 degrees lower than what it is when you get into it for a good soak is optimal. It is better to leave your hot tub on all the time than to turn if off every time you finish your bath. The hot tub will consume less energy if the water temperature is maintained and is well insulated. Generally, you should set the temperature of your hot tub to between 98 and 104 degrees fahrenheit (36 and 40 degrees celsius), even when not using it.
